From that:
"If the violation is not serious, the safety of pedestrians, passengers, and the general public is not affected, and the driver is a tourist the transit agent must issue a courtesy violation. This warning may only be issued to tourists who violate the transit regulations and will not generate a monetary penalty. Its objective is to indicate which violation was committed and to enforce the rules of transportation. The courtesy ticket may only be issued on two occasions to the same vehicle and/or driver."

NADCAPTURE CROCODILE SWIMMING IN WESTERN HOTEL POOL
At the same accommodation center in the year 2019, a crocodile attacked a tourist who went swimming in the swimming pool
#Cozumel. – Workers at the Western hotel, located at kilometer 17 of the south coastal road, noticed the presence of the crocodile of more than two meters, which entered the swimming pool early Thursday morning.
Immediately, the presence of the staff of the Ecology Sub-Direction was requested to capture the reptile that, at the time, remained calm inside the pool.
The crocodile was caught without any setbacks, even hours later it was moved and released on the "Punta Sur" ecological reserve, in its natural habitat.
It should be remembered that, in the same hotel, in November 2019, a crocodile attack was recorded towards a tourist who entered to bathe in the pool, who suffered head injuries and had to be transferred to the hospital.
Luckily, the tourist suffered no serious injuries, who was known to have entered for a dip during the dawn, when the crocodile remained at the bottom of the pool.
